Troops Uncover Illegal Oil Bunkering Sites In Delta State

Troops of the Nigerian Army (NA) in synergy with personnel of the Nigerian Security and Civil Defence Corps (NSCDC) discovered 12 active illegal refining sites, 60 crude oil cooking ovens, 14 reservoirs, 6 wooden boats laden with stolen crude and 470 sacks of illegally refined Automotive Gas Oil (AGO) concealed in the camps in Delta state.

A statement by the Director of Army Public Relations, Brigadier General Onyema Nwachukwu said that this is in continuation of the crackdown on saboteurs of Nigeria’s oil sector in Southern Nigeria.

The Troops of 181 Amphibious Battalion conducting anti-oil theft operations on  Saturday 2 September 2023, cracked down on oil thieves’ camps in Owahwa Creek in Ughelli South Local Government Area of Delta state.

The troops also intercepted a vehicle conveying 25 polytene bags of suspected illegally refined AGO in the Ogbodu Community in Udu Local Government Area of Delta State.

In a similar operation, also conducted on 2 September 2023, troops of 3 Battalion, intercepted two wooden boats ladened with stolen crude in Tsekelewu, Warri North Local Government Area of Delta state. The troops also arrested two suspects in connection with the crime. Both suspects and the illegal products have been handed over to NSCDC personnel attached to Tantita Security Services for further action.

The Nigerian Army called on members of the public to report any suspected act of sabotage or criminality to security agencies to enhance ongoing operations to curb economic sabotage in the country.
